## Authentication

Heads up: the nightly reindex job (`reindex_nightly.py`) talks to the Lanternfish search cluster, and that cluster won't accept anonymous writes anymore — we locked it down last sprint. The job now authenticates as the `reindex-runner` service identity against Corvid Gateway, and the token is injected via the `LF_INDEX_TOKEN` env var in the scheduler config. Nothing clever going on, just a bearer header on every batch request. For review purposes, the staging credential currently in use is listed below.

service key, kadug-kadup: kto15_rN23XLAYImmZgrJ

Subject: Key rotation — AgriPulse telemetry gateway

Welcome aboard. We rotated credentials for the AgriPulse gateway this morning; the old key stops working Friday. The gateway forwards tractor and irrigation telemetry to the internal FieldSink service, and every forwarder instance you deploy needs the new credential in its config. Don't reuse it anywhere else, and don't commit it. Update your local environment with the key below.

service key, fawip-bajef: kto11_Qt5wZK9vdNC

Tilecask is our cache layer sitting between the Mapforge renderer and the clients. Most env vars are boring: TILECASK_PORT, TILECASK_TTL_HOURS, and TILECASK_MAX_DISK_GB do what you'd expect. The tricky one is the upstream purge hook—Tilecask won't accept purge requests without authenticating to the renderer first. Put that purge credential in the env file right after this sentence.

vault entry, yahif-yajep: COURIER_KEY29=b802bdf8034096b65a51c6ba5abe2